(Q) Can I retract a bid?
|
|
(A) Totalbids does not allow bid retraction. In rare circumstances you may contact the seller directly. Note that sellers will very rarely allow bid retractions unless it is for a typographical error (i.e.: you accidentally bid £990 instead of £9.90). If the seller does not agree to the bid retraction and you default on payment they will leave negative feedback for you. |

(Q) The auction is finished but the buyer/seller hasn’t contacted me to pay for/send the item?
|
|
(A) Most buyers/sellers will be in touch soon after the auction ends but people do go on holiday, fall ill and have busy periods that may cause delay. If you do not hear from the buyer/seller within a few days you should contact them directly by email. If after several attempts over several weeks you still do not hear from them you are free to leave negative feedback but please do give them at least 3 weeks to respond first. |

(Q) I've received an email from PayPal, how do I know it's genuine?
|
|
(A) PayPal will email you when someone has paid into your account or if you change your registered email address, password, etc... These emails can always be verified by logging into your PayPal account. Be sure to open a new browser and type in www.paypal.com - do NOT follow links in an email unless you are 100% sure it's genuine. PayPal will NEVER email you telling you to post goods or re-enter credit card details or passwords, etc... Hundreds of scam emails go out every day from fraudsters proporting to be PayPal so be careful and always verify the email by logging into PayPal manually, not by following a link. |
